1. **Basic Settings:**
– Before diving into more advanced adjustments, it is crucial to familiarize yourself with the basic settings of the XP Deus. These include sensitivity, discrimination levels, ground balance, audio response, and frequency selection.
– Sensitivity determines how deeply your detector can detect metals. Higher sensitivity levels can help you detect smaller or deeper targets but may also result in increased interference from mineralized soil or nearby objects.
– Discrimination allows you to filter out unwanted targets based on their conductivity level. Adjusting discrimination levels can help you focus on specific types of metals while ignoring others.
– Ground balance ensures optimal performance by compensating for mineralization in the soil. Proper ground balancing minimizes false signals and enhances target detection accuracy.
– Audio response controls how your detector sounds when it detects a target. You can choose between different audio modes depending on your preferences.
– Frequency selection enables you to adjust the operating frequency of your detector based on environmental factors and target types.
2. **Advanced Settings:**
– Once you have mastered the basic settings, you can explore more advanced options offered by the XP Deus:
– Multi-Tone: This setting assigns different tones to various target categories, making it easier for users to distinguish between desirable and undesirable finds.
– Notch Discrimination: By creating notches in your discrimination pattern, you can exclude specific target ranges from detection while still capturing valuable items within those ranges.
– Iron Volume: Iron Volume allows you to control the volume level for iron targets specifically. This feature helps in identifying iron artifacts without being overwhelmed by their signals.
– Reactivity: Reactivity influences how quickly your detector responds to multiple targets close together. Lower reactivity levels are suitable for dense trash areas, while higher reactivity levels are ideal for separating adjacent targets efficiently.
